Baby care games or games for a toddler?
These are different requests. Baby care games let the player act as a caregiver. A game for a toddler needs controls, pace and instructions that the child can manage. Use the care selections here for the first request; our age guides and little-kids collection offer other starting points for the second.
Preview a task together: check how much reading it needs, whether dragging is required and whether the child can reach the buttons. Difficulty varies between games, so this collection has no single age rating.
